Hurricane Fiona

    Hurricane Fiona Caicos islands

    Hurricane Fiona Causes Heavy Rainfall and Floods

    Josie
    Hurricane Fiona strengthened further after it claimed seven lives at least. US forecasters say the storm will continue increasing its strength, though it turned...
    Hurricane Fiona

    Latest articles

    - Advertisement - spot_imgspot_img